OnePlus has officially launched its OnePlus 6T McLaren Edition in an event held at McLaren’s headquarters in the UK. The limited edition smartphone features 10 GB RAM and a new fast-charging technology called Warp Charge 30.

Under its partnership with the British automotive company, the latest 6T edition comes with the McLaren’s iconic “Papaya Orange” colored shade that runs around the bottom edges of the smartphone.

With the new edition of its current flagship, OnePlus has also introduced Warp Charge 30 which is touted to provide you a day’s power with just 20 minutes of charging. In this new and even faster wired charging technology, 30 Watts of power flows through the smartphone while charging.

This new fast-charging technology makes it 38% faster than the company’s proprietary Fast Charging technology.

OnePlus 6T McLaren Edition has been launched with 256 GB of storage and is priced at $699. The price is on a relatively higher end, given OnePlus’ strategy to price their phones aggressively against other flagship Android devices.

The McLaren co-branded smartphone’s accessories are also “Papaya Orange” colored with the orange and black color scheme in USB-C cable and headphone dongle, a McLaren branded case, a piece of carbon fiber from McLaren’s F1 car and a hardcover book highlighting the history of the British automaker.

When compared to the OnePlus 6T standard edition, the McLaren Edition has 2GB more RAM and Warp Charge 30 to more efficiently fuel up the smartphone.

OnePlus 6T McLaren Edition has been launched in North America and Western Europe and will be launched in India tomorrow.
